The Issue
As a resident of Shelby County, and a parent of children who have been educated in our elementary, middle, and high schools, I believe that our county should hold the highest standards of health and virus prevention for our faculty, administrators, employees, and students. As you read this, the Shelby County Schools board is moving forward with a plan that does not require masks or face-coverings when schools reopen this August. This is unacceptable.
The CDC and the medical community at large overwhelmingly agree that wearing masks or face-coverings reduces transmission of COVID-19 significantly. Shelby County is an exceptional community, with communities and neighborhoods full of people who care not only about themselves but others. This simple act, albeit somewhat inconvenient, can and will greatly reduce the spread of this virus, and could even save the life of one of our beloved educators, librarians, administrators, custodians, resource officers or one of our own children.
We are better than the direction our school board is poised to take. Let's let them hear loud and clear that the citizens of Shelby County want the best, not only educationally for our students, but also in regards to their health.
